    Re: What do you feed your crestie?

    Quote Originally Posted by fishmommy View Post
    hold on everyone! am I to understand that you don't HAVE to feed crickets to cresties?

    I would love to keep cresties but have avoided them because I thought that crickets were necessary (and I HATE crickets!).

    wow...this could be a life-altering bit of information for me
    I better go read up on some crestie caresheets

    I am new to the Crestie world but based on my reading, you don't have to feed crickets as long as you feed the gcd. The crickets and other insects do add some nice nutrition though which will help make your gecko "fat and happy." They will grow bigger and stronger. I don't think I can do crickets again, I had a very bad experience where one cricket kept attacking my gecko even though it was gut loaded for 2 days prior and I have my gecko in a separate feeding tank so no crickets get left behind. Needless to say, my gecko did not like this and I am not sure her will eat crickets after this. I'm thinking of dubias, or some sort of worm. 1. they freak me out less and 2. I do not believe they will attack my gecko. I need to do more research on that though.
